The unit conversion is a fundamental process that enables accurate and coherent communication and computation across various fields and applications.

Unit conversion maintains a quantity's value in different units, crucial for consistency and clarity.

It enables comparisons between measurements using diverse units.

Facilitates communication across different measurement systems.

Ensures meaningful and applicable calculation results in various contexts.

For instance, converting grams to ounces allows accurate measurement in recipes using different units.

[tex]\[ 500 \text{ grams} \times 0.035 \frac{\text{ounces}}{\text{gram}} = 17.5 \text{ ounces} \][/tex]

For the recipe, 17.5 ounces of flour are needed for precise measurement.

In scientific research, unit conversion is vital for standardizing data presentation.

International trade relies on unit conversion to ensure consistent pricing across different measurement systems.

Overall, unit conversion is fundamental for accurate communication and computation in diverse fields and applications.

Final answer:

NF3 exhibits a trigonal pyramidal shape due to its sp³ hybridization, with three bonded fluorine atoms and one lone pair of electrons on the nitrogen atom.

Explanation:

The molecule in question is NF3, which consists of one nitrogen atom (N) and three fluorine atoms (F). The nitrogen atom in NF3 is sp³ hybridized, utilizing one sp³ hybrid orbital to form a bond with each of the three fluorine atoms, and the remaining sp³ hybrid orbital accommodates a lone pair of electrons. Considering the presence of three bonded pairs and one lone pair of electrons on the nitrogen atom, the molecular geometry of NF3 is trigonal pyramidal. This geometric shape resembles a tetrahedron with one vertex missing, due to the presence of the lone electron pair on nitrogen, which slightly distorts the angles between the bonds.
